    Hello
    I have a DELL inspiron 5160 notebook
    P4 HT 3.02ghz, 512MB, 40GB
    I tried turning it on this morning, and all it does is shows the dell splash screen in the center which loads a bar (I assume its running its POST) it gets 3/4 way through it and restarts over and over again.
    It wont let me get into the BIOS either.
    I tried removing each hardware @ a time, no luck..I am currently at a point where I only have the MB+RAM+LCD connected and I still get the same problem.
    When I removed the RAM, I did not get any BEEPS

    Any help will be gladly appreciated

    Have you tried contacting them?

    My only ideas would be removing the battery and run straight off the AC adapter.

    Some models have a variety of Hotkey options.

    I'd try all your Hotkeys: F1; F2; F3; etc.

    Some also use a combination of say Ctrl+F11 etc.

    The object of these keys is to access a total recovery procedure.
